Ready to improve your basketball skills? It's time to master the basics. These beginner drills will guide you in building a strong foundation for your game.

First up, let's work through dribbling. This improving basketball skills critical skill will ensure your possession of the ball. Practice static dribbling to improve your control, and then move onto moving dribbling drills to work your quickness.

Next, we'll concentrate on to shooting. A good shot initiates with the accurate form. Drill shooting from different ranges to build your accuracy. Remember to follow through and aim for the center of the basket.

Finally, don't forget about passing! This vital skill allows you to distribute the ball with your players. Practice chest passes, bounce passes, and overhead passes to improve your precision.

Getting Started with Basketball

So you wanna jump into the game? Awesome! Basketball is a intense sport that's a blast to play. Before you hit the court, let's go over the basics.

  • Here's the deal, you need to score by shooting it through the other team's basket. Each successful shot is worth two or three points, depending on where on the court you are.
